Molecular engineering of enzymes

Molecular engineering of enzymes


The work of our laboratory focuses on the study of the protein structure-function relationship of a wide variety of enzymes of industrial interest. We try to obtain enzymes with improved properties combining experimental approaches of rational design and directed evolution.

Physics of low-mass stars, exoplanets and associated instrumentation

Physics of low-mass stars, exoplanets and associated instrumentation


The group develops the line of research that studies the physics of very low-mass stars and their exoplanets.In the last years, the community has focused on these objects because of the great interest they present for the discovery of habitable exo-Earths. Therefore, it is very needed to deepen in the knowledge of these stellar systems in all possible aspects, from the general statistics to the physics of their formation, evolution and the internal structure of their stars.

Stellar Variability Group

Stellar Variability Group


The Group's research focuses mainly on the study of stellar structures, through asteroseismology, exoplanets, statistics, star clusters, stellar atmospheres, etc. In particular, the Group is involved in theoretical and observational research, as well as instrumental and technological evelopment both for ground-based telescopes and for scientific payloads on board space missions. For this we have developed specific instrumentation for the OSN, and we have participated in the design and exploitation of the space missions CoRoT and Kepler and completed, TESS and BRITE.

Selective Oxidation Catalysts and Processes (Selective Oxidation Group, SELOXI)

Selective Oxidation Catalysts and Processes (Selective Oxidation Group, SELOXI)


Since almost 30 years, the Group is devoted to the preparation and characterization of catalysts, studies of kinetics and mechanisms of selective oxidation catalytic reactions and their applications, combustion and reforming, such as: oxidative activation of light alkanes with different types of mixed, nanostructured and mesoporous (with redox properties) oxides; catalytic combustion using perovskites; selective oxidation by unconventional oxidants (CO2, H2+O2); technological research of novel selective oxidation reactions for industry; and reforming of renewable raw materials.

Advanced uses of Ecomaterials from the agricultural industry

Advanced uses of Ecomaterials from the agricultural industry


Agricultural residues are being used as Renewable Raw Materiales (RRM) for use in a wide variety of projects. Given their origen, these materials are economically very competitve with the conventionally used synthetic materials and also help to close a circle where the residues produced from one industry can be used in the same or another as a RRM, thus reducing the amount of waste and helping towards a sustainable economy.

Atmospheric Chemistry and Climate Group

Atmospheric Chemistry and Climate Group


The Atmospheric Chemistry and Climate group (AC2) is a newly created research group within CSIC¿s Institute of Physical Chemistry Rocasolano (IQFR). The group initiated its research activities in Augoust 2009 in Toledo as the former Laboratory for Atmospheric and Climate Science, since December 2012 AC2 is based at IQFR in Madrid. AC2 research efforts are directed at studying the role of atmospheric composition and chemistry in the climate system.

Euro-Atlantic and Mediterranean Studies Group

Euro-Atlantic and Mediterranean Studies Group


This group studies the multiple dimensions of relations between the two sides of the Atlantic and within the Mediterranean area. Its members have extensive experience in research on transfers and exchanges between the United States and Europe, the interactions of European nations in the Mediterranean environment, and the emergence of processes in the different countries that have given rise to processes of influence and hybridization at various levels.

Ultrasonic Systems and Technologies (USTG)

Ultrasonic Systems and Technologies (USTG)


Research and development of technology for medical and industrial applications, particularly through ultrasonic, nuclear, and nanoparticle-based techniques. This is a multidisciplinary group composed of experts in physics, materials science, electronics, signal processing, and systems engineering, whose aim is to provide solutions to complex problems—ranging from the study of the underlying physical phenomena to the development of systems transferable to society. GROUP OF STUDIES ON ASIA AND THE PACIFIC (GAP)

GROUP OF STUDIES ON ASIA AND THE PACIFIC (GAP)


This group studies Spain’s projection in Asia and the Pacific from a historical perspective, as well as the colonial and postcolonial processes, international relations, and contacts and interactions between societies that helped shape this area.
